Search for your exact model number + “mstarupgrade.bin” on the manufacturer’s support site or trusted forums. Do not use generic files from random websites.
Most modern budget and mid-range Smart TVs run on chipsets. The Mstarupgrade.bin file is the raw binary firmware image used by the TV’s bootloader to perform a low-level reinstallation of the operating system.
